Start your day with a visit to Dubai Marina, a bustling waterfront district known for its stunning skyline and luxurious yachts. Stroll along the promenade, take in the panoramic views, and enjoy a leisurely breakfast at one of the many cafes overlooking the marina (estimated cost: $20). Spend around 2 hours exploring this vibrant neighborhood.
No trip to Dubai is complete without a visit to the iconic Burj Khalifa, the tallest building in the world. Take the elevator to the observation deck on the 148th floor and marvel at the breathtaking views of the city and beyond (estimated cost: $40). Spend approximately 1.5 hours here, soaking in the awe-inspiring sights.
Adjacent to the Burj Khalifa is the Dubai Mall, a shopper's paradise and a destination in itself. Explore the mall's vast array of shops, from high-end designer brands to local boutiques. Take a break for lunch at one of the diverse restaurants or enjoy a quick bite at the food court (estimated cost: $30). Allow around 2 hours for shopping and dining.
Embark on an exhilarating desert safari adventure to experience the natural wonders of Dubai's Arabian Desert. Ride over the golden sand dunes in a 4x4 vehicle, try your hand at sandboarding, and enjoy a traditional camel ride (estimated cost: $100). This thrilling experience will last approximately 5 hours, including a desert sunset and a delicious BBQ dinner under the starlit sky.
Wrap up your day with a visit to the Dubai Fountain, located in the heart of Downtown Dubai. This captivating musical fountain show is a sight to behold, with water jets dancing in sync with music and lights. Find a cozy spot along the waterfront promenade and enjoy the enchanting performance (free admission, runs every 30 minutes). Spend around 30 minutes here, taking in the magical atmosphere.
For those seeking off-the-beaten-path attractions, consider visiting Al Bastakiya, the oldest residential area in Dubai. Explore the narrow alleyways and traditional wind-tower houses, now housing art galleries and cafes. Another local favorite is the Dubai Spice Souk, a vibrant market where you can immerse yourself in the fragrant aromas of spices, herbs, and traditional Arabic perfumes.
